Went here for the second time to try their raw bar happy hour. Overall it's a solid addition to their regular happy hour. The clams weren't the best so I wouldn't get those again but I would try the dozen mussels for $5. The oysters were good. Not quite as good as KSOB happy hour oysters in my opinion, BUT considering I no longer live near a KSOB and this is near my house this is great. The basket of tots was HUGE and only $2 more than the side of tots. My partner ordered the salmon salad. It came with a big piece of salmon and she enjoyed it. Falls Church has an ever growing number of restaurants but Dogwood is one of the best around. The inside feels like an Irish pub with lots of wood and brick (even a fireplace in the winter) and a patio out back during good weather. They have a varied menu with something for everyone, including lots of bar type food. This trip was just a visit to the bar to have a beer and some nachos. They have a good draft beer selection featuring many local/Virginia beers. The nachos are huge and made with real cheese, not the fake cheese sauce like you get at the ballpark. The steak is tasty and worth the few extra bucks. Bartenders are friendly and it's one of the few NoVa places where patrons even talk to each other at the bar. Friendly local place that I'll be back to again.
